How I think
These are the principles I apply to every project.
In clinical environments, overloaded practitioners don't just make poor design choices — they make errors. Every design decision starts by asking: what cognitive resources does this system demand, and at what cost?
Clinicians don't trust or distrust a system — they calibrate trust continuously based on outputs, failures, and context. When that calibration breaks — through automation bias or opacity — adoption collapses. I design systems that support appropriate trust, not unconditional reliance.
An AI explanation that appears at the wrong moment, in the wrong format, or in the wrong level of detail is no explanation at all. Explainability only works when it maps to how clinicians actually reason under time pressure.
Most AI systems that fail in deployment were never evaluated for how they fit into real cognitive workflows. I use cognitive task analysis, mental model mapping, and human factors methods to identify adoption risks before they become live failures.
As AI autonomy increases, preserving meaningful human oversight isn't a compliance checkbox — it's a core design constraint. I design for environments where the human must remain in control, even when the AI is more accurate.
